About this course

Physical computing and robotics are rapidly growing fields, but understanding the foundational programming needed to control hardware can be challenging. This course provides a structured introduction to physical computing, teaching you how to combine the power of Python programming with the versatility of the Raspberry Pi microcomputer. You will gain the practical skills necessary to translate mechanical designs into functional, programmable robotic systems. What you'll learn: * Understand the fundamental architecture and setup of the Raspberry Pi for physical computing projects. * Configure Python environments and apply modern structured programming principles for hardware control. * Interface with common robotic components, including motors, servos, and various digital and analog sensors. * Apply basic control algorithms and state machine logic to create autonomous robot behaviors. * Practice writing clean, testable Python code for reliable sensor data processing and motor actuation. The course begins with essential concepts of physical computing and Python setup, progresses through input (sensors) and output (motors) control, and culminates in implementing full control logic for an autonomous robot system. All lessons rely on clear written explanations and detailed, runnable code snippets. This course is designed for absolute beginners with no prior experience in robotics or physical computing.
